Please see individual commit messages for details. The first 3 commits contain mechanical formatting changes and are optional. The series can be taken without them. I avoided more significant formatting or changes where possible to reduce the diff. Unfortunately `scripts/generate_rust_analyzer.py` is not consistently formatted before nor after this series. The 5th commit ("scripts: generate_rust_analyzer.py: use str(pathlib.Path)") can also be considered optional. It removes an inconsistency I noticed while working on this series and which occurs on a line which churns in this series anyway.
